The foundation of any thriving landscape begins with recognizing the local climate and soil conditions. By selecting native plants and trees, you significantly enhance the sustainability of your garden. Native species are inherently adapted to the local environment, requiring less water and fertilizers, and are more resistant to local pests and diseases. This not only conserves resources but also supports local biodiversity, fostering a balanced ecosystem.

Water conservation is another cornerstone of sustainable landscaping. Traditional lawns and gardens often consume substantial amounts of water, particularly during dry seasons. To combat this, we incorporate water-efficient strategies such as drip irrigation systems and rainwater harvesting into our designs. Drip irrigation delivers water directly to the plant's roots, minimizing evaporation and runoff, while rainwater harvesting systems collect and store water for use during periods of drought.
Composting is a simple yet highly effective practice that transforms organic waste into nutrient-rich soil enhancers. By composting plant clippings, leaves, and food scraps, you create a natural fertilizer that improves soil health and reduces the need for synthetic fertilizers. This practice not only supports sustainable plant growth but also reduces waste, diminishing the carbon footprint of your landscaping activities.
Moreover, the strategic use of mulch can greatly benefit your garden’s health and sustainability. Mulch acts as a barrier to weeds, conserves soil moisture, and adds organic matter back into the soil as it breaks down. Our landscaping philosophy also embraces the concept of permaculture, a holistic approach that strives to mimic the natural environment. By observing and applying patterns from nature, we design landscapes that are self-sustaining. This includes planting perennials and companion plants that work symbiotically, reducing the need for conventional interventions over time.
